    Position Overview

    Proterra seeks an experienced Sr. Network Engineer to join our expanding team. In this role you will be analyzing, planning, implementing, maintaining, and troubleshooting network solutions on premise, at the datacenter, in the cloud, and across our IoT environment. In this role you will lead network technology upgrade or expansion projects, including installation of hardware, software, and integration testing, as well as coordinating these activities without disturbing function of other systems. Additionally, you will be managing and maintaining existing infrastructure while monitoring and diagnosing any performance issues. Our ideal candidate will have excellent problem-solving skills along with a thorough knowledge of network architecture and administration. You will work with our team of engineers for optimizing the network usage, and for security and data protection of our networks.

    About the Role – You will:
    • Maintain network availability for campus, datacenter, WAN, and cloud networks.
    • Develop and build out network infrastructure for projects with hands on involvement in network planning, network architecture design and engineering.
    • Install, configure, and maintain various network hosts and services like routers, switches, firewalls, VPN endpoints.
    • Design, implementation and configuration of next generation firewalls including application visibility, threat prevention, network security mitigation strategies and IDS/ISP solutions.
    • Provide technical input in reviewing architecture, policies, and procedures.
    • Optimize reliability, performance, supportability, and security of our production infrastructure.
    • Design corporate standards and develop network enhancements.
    • Work on issues of varying complexity surrounding network planning, configuration, and optimization.
    • Integrate communication architectures, topologies, hardware, software, transmission and signaling links and protocols into complete network configurations.
    • Develop capacity plans for new and existing infrastructure.
    • Perform network maintenances/upgrades (often during normal working hours, but sometimes during the evening or weekend)
    • Troubleshoot network issues and outages, overseeing unique or escalated issues.
    • Identify and assist in implementing monitoring to ensure health, performance and security of our production and non-production cloud infrastructure.
    • Work directly with ISP/Vendors on fixing any issues related to network.
    • Manage configuration of network encryptions methods including IPsec Site to Site VPN tunnels utilizing Palo Alto, Cisco Manage FW's and Palo Alto GlobalProtect VPN client access with multifactor authentication. Palo Alto HIP checking.
    • Manage Network access controls including Radius & 802.1x for wired and wireless access such as Cisco ISE (Base, Plus, Apex), Ruckus, and Brocade.
    • Manage application access control utilizing multifactor authentication and Palo Alto platforms integration with OKTA.
    • Manage PCI DSS and DMZ network security design, implementation, and support.
    • Manage zero-trust frameworks and architecture for network services.
    • Able to document setup on an ongoing basis for on prem and cloud environment – network diagrams.
    • Assist in the development and documentation of technical standards and implements approved methods of procedure.
    • Responds to networking issues generated via alerting systems, service desk, or Tier 1-4 tickets.
    • Participate in on-call rotation and respond to after hour alerts.

    Your Experience Includes:
    • Minimum 8 years in the IT networking field, with 5 of those years managing and troubleshooting a complex LAN/WAN environment with 10 or more sites.
    • Bachelor's Degree in Computer Science, Information Systems or related field/or relevant experience
    • High Availability networks utilizing Cisco Routers and Switches such as ISR Routers, Catalyst Switches & Nexus 9K/7K/5K.
    • Network Security best practices utilizing Palo Alto 7000, 3000 & 5000 NextGen Firewalls
    • Routing Protocols including BGP, OSPF, EIGRP with redistribution.
    • WAN technologies - MPLS, DMVPN, Site to Site VPN
    • QoS (including voice prioritization)
    • Must have cloud networking experience in AWS.
    • Prefer experience with AWS Transit Gateway, Cisco, Brocade, Palo-Alto Firewalls
